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Espresso Machine And Grinder Combo

Choosing the best espresso machine and grinder combo involves considering multiple factors that impact both performance and usability. Buyers should think about their skill level, how much space they have, and how much they’re willing to spend. Getting the right balance between automation and customization can make the experience more enjoyable and consistent. Below, I outline key factors to help you make a smarter purchase decision and avoid common pitfalls in this category.

Performance and Grind Quality

Look for machines with powerful pressure (at least 15 bars) and consistent temperature control, which are essential for a quality espresso shot. The grinder’s burr type and grind settings significantly influence flavor; conical burrs tend to produce less heat and preserve aroma. An adjustable grinder allows customization for different beans and roast levels, improving your overall experience. Avoid models with fixed grind settings that limit flexibility, especially if you plan to experiment with various coffee types.

Ease of Use and Automation

Ease of operation is key, particularly for beginners. Machines with intuitive controls, programmable settings, and clear displays reduce the learning curve. Automated features like dose control and milk frothing simplify the process, ensuring consistent results without requiring expert barista skills. However, overly complex machines can be daunting, so consider your comfort with manual adjustments versus automation. Balance convenience with control based on your experience level.

Build Quality and Durability

Investing in a sturdy build, preferably with stainless steel components, pays off over time. Cheaper plastics may save money initially but can degrade or break with frequent use. A well-constructed machine will last longer and maintain performance, especially if you plan to brew daily. Check for quality reviews on the machine’s durability, especially of key parts like the grinder burrs and steam wand.

Size and Maintenance

Consider your available space and whether the machine’s footprint fits comfortably in your kitchen. Compact models are ideal for smaller areas but may compromise on features or capacity. Maintenance ease, including cleaning and descaling, is often overlooked but crucial for long-term performance. Machines with removable parts and clear cleaning instructions help sustain quality over time.

Price and Value

Higher-priced models tend to offer more customization, better build quality, and additional features like PID temperature control or multiple grind settings. However, budget options can still produce satisfying espresso, especially for casual users. Focus on getting the best performance within your budget, and don’t overspend on features you won’t use. Remember, a well-maintained mid-range machine can outperform a poorly cared-for high-end unit.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is it better to buy an all-in-one machine or separate grinder and espresso machine?

Choosing an all-in-one combo simplifies setup and saves space, making it ideal for beginners or those with limited kitchen real estate. However, separate machines often perform better in their specific roles, offering superior grind quality and brewing control. If you’re serious about espresso and willing to invest more, separate units can provide higher consistency and longevity. For casual use, an all-in-one machine can deliver satisfying results without the complexity and cost of separate components.

Can I get cafe-quality espresso with a home combo machine?

Yes, with the right machine and grinder, you can approach cafe-quality espresso at home. Key factors include a powerful pump, good temperature stability, and an adjustable grinder for precise dosing. Keep in mind that consistency also depends on your technique and beans used. While some high-end home combos can rival cafes, mastering the process still requires some practice and patience. Regular maintenance and quality beans are essential to achieve the best results.

What features should I prioritize if I want to make milk-based drinks like lattes and cappuccinos?

A good milk frother or steam wand is vital for creating rich, velvety milk. Look for machines with a manual steam wand if you want more control, or automatic frothing for convenience. Adjustable temperature and pressure settings also help craft the perfect foam. Bear in mind that some budget models may struggle to produce consistently good milk textures, so choose a machine with a reputable steam system if milk-based drinks are a priority.

Are more grind settings always better?

More grind settings provide finer control over the coffee grounds, which can lead to better extraction and flavor. However, too many options can also be overwhelming, especially for beginners. A range of 20-40 settings usually strikes a good balance, allowing you to fine-tune without confusion. Ultimately, the key is how well the grinder performs in practice—precision matters more than sheer number of settings, particularly if the machine’s burrs are of high quality.

How often should I clean and maintain my combo machine?

Regular cleaning is essential for maintaining flavor and machine longevity. A daily rinse of the brew head and steam wand, along with weekly descaling, helps prevent buildup. The grinder burrs should be checked periodically for wear, and replacement may be needed after several hundred pounds of coffee. Following the manufacturer’s maintenance schedule ensures your machine continues to produce high-quality espresso and prolongs its lifespan.
